#074191 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#074191 is composed of 2.7% red, 25.5%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 214.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 29.8%. #074191 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e82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#074191 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#074191 has RGB values of R:7, G:65,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 475537.

Shades and Tints of #074191
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060e is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#074191
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474b51 is the less saturated color, while #014097 is the most saturated one.
